在PHP中,你可以使用多种方法来设置文件的编码格式。下面是一些常见的方法:
1. 使用`header()`函数设置响应的字符编码:
```php
header('Content-Type: text/html; charset=UTF-8');
```
这将在HTTP响应中设置字符编码为UTF-8。请确保在输出任何内容之前调用此函数。
2. 在HTML文件的`<head>`标签中设置字符编码:
```html
<meta charset="UTF-8">
```
这将在HTML文档中设置字符编码为UTF-8。这是一种常见的做法,用于确保浏览器正确解释页面内容的编码。
3. 在创建文件时设置编码格式:
如果你使用文本编辑器创建PHP文件,你可以在设置中指定文件的编码格式。大多数现代文本编辑器都提供了编码设置选项,如UTF-8、UTF-8无BOM等。确保在保存文件时选择正确的编码格式。
4. 使用`mb_internal_encoding()`函数设置内部字符编码:
```php
mb_internal_encoding('UTF-8');
```
这将设置PHP的内部字符编码为UTF-8。请注意,这仅影响使用多字节字符串函数(如`mb_strlen()`)时的字符编码。它不会改变文件的实际编码格式。
这些方法可以帮助你设置文件的编码格式。请根据你的具体需求选择适合的方法。